Green Beret Staff Sgt. Ryan Maseth was stationed at a base in Iraq that used to be one of Saddam's palaces. This 24-year-old Pittsburgh native stepped into the shower in January, 2008.
The water pump was not properly grounded, and when he turned on the shower, a jolt of electricity shot through his body and electrocuted him...There have been 18 electrocution deaths, hundreds of burns, and untold numbers of fires due to bad wiring in Iraq.
The surging current left burn marks across his body, even singeing his hair. Army reports show that he probably suffered a long, painful death.
